Rhythm City is back on South African television. The Rhythm City eTV return brings the popular soapie to eTV Extra, Channel 195 on DStv as a rerun. Furthermore, viewers can relive the storylines that made the show a household name for over a decade. Reruns begin today at 11:20am.
Rhythm City eTV Return: The Details
Rhythm City officially returns as a rerun on eTV Extra, Channel 195 on DStv. The show airs daily at 11:20am. It ended five years ago in 2021 after a 14-year run. The show built its reputation around the lives of people chasing their dreams in the music industry. It became one of eTV’s most successful original productions. As a result, its cancellation in 2021 left a significant gap in local television that many viewers have felt ever since.
A Show That Defined a Generation
Rhythm City first aired on eTV on 9 July 2007. It replaced the youth soapie Backstage in the early evening timeslot. The show quickly found a massive audience. Furthermore, it became a launching pad for numerous South African actors and musicians over the years.
The production was deeply affected by tragedy in August 2017. Cast member Dumi Masilela was killed in a hijacking. His death shook the cast, crew and viewers across the country. Furthermore, a special episode was filmed in his memory to honour his contribution to the show.
When eTV announced the show would not be renewed in 2021, the response from viewers was immediate and emotional. Many took to social media to express their disappointment. However, the final episode aired and the show closed its doors after 14 years.
